BIO

Tina Fey is a writer, actor, and producer known for her award-winning series "30 Rock" and for nine seasons on "Saturday Night Live" (Weekend Update, Sarah Palin, Mom Jeans.) Films: Sisters, Whiskey Tango Foxtrot, Date Night, Mean Girls (her first screenplay). In 2010 she became the youngest recipient of the Mark Twain Prize for American Humor. Her book Bossypants has sold 2.5 million copies. She co-created "Unbreakable Kimmy Schmidt" (Netflix) and is an Executive Producer on "Great News" (NBC). She is thrilled to make her Broadway debut as a writer and not as a dancer in Cats as previously stress-dreamt. She lives in NYC with her husband Jeff Richmond and their two fancy daughters.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

How many shows has Tina Fey written?

Tina Fey has written 1 shows including Mean Girls (Bookwriter).

What awards has Tina Fey been nominated for?

Best Book of a Musical (BroadwayWorld Awards) for Mean Girls, Outstanding Book of a Musical (Drama Desk Awards) for Mean Girls, Outstanding Book of a Musical (Outer Critics Circle Awards) for Mean Girls and Best Book of a Musical (Tony Awards) for Mean Girls.

What awards has Tina Fey won?

Tina Fey has won several awards for her work on Mean Girls, including Best Book of a Musical at the BroadwayWorld Awards, Outstanding Book of a Musical at the Drama Desk Awards, and Outstanding Book of a Musical at the Outer Critics Circle Awards.
